Three intrepid ladies boarded the Sabrina 5 barge, moored next to the National Waterways Museum in Gloucester Docks. All complete beginners at needlefelting. We

started the course with a little experimentation, felting faces - this they enjoyed so much I more or less had to wrest the wool and needles from them and suggest we get on with their projects for the day!


All three had chosen to make hares and I demonstrated making a wire armature frame for a hare and then gave everyone their own wire to make their own frames. The day passed quickly, as they always do when you are having fun, we stopped only for lunch and the occasional cuppa.


We took a class shot at the end, with the three hares - didn't they do well?!
